PHILADELPHIA - All eyes are on a new trend for surfers meant to ensure their safety.
Surfers are putting big eye stickers on the bottoms of their boards in order to fend off sharks.
Great whites are known to attack surfers and are known for sneaking up on their prety rather than being conspicuous.
It's believed seeing those eyes will make the sharks think they have lost the element of surprise on their prey and deter them from attacking.
